@CHARSET "UTF-8";

HTML {
font-family : Tahoma, Arial, Sans-Serif;
font-size : 12px;
font-weight : normal;
color : #444444;
text-decoration : none;
}

BODY {
font-family : Tahoma, Arial, Sans-Serif;
font-size : 100%;
font-weight : normal;
font : 12px Tahoma, Arial, Sans-Serif;
color : #444444;
text-decoration : none;
background-color: #ffffff;
}

DIV {
font-family : Tahoma, Arial, Sans-Serif;
font-size : 12px;
font : 12px Tahoma, Arial, Sans-Serif;
color : #444444;
text-decoration : none;
line-height : 150%;
}

div.wrap {
position: relative;
text-align : left;
width : 1000px;
margin : auto;
}

.clr {
padding-bottom : 0px !important;
padding-top : 0px !important;
padding-left : 0px !important;
padding-right : 0px !important;
line-height : 0 !important;
margin : 0px;
min-height : 0px !important;
display : block;
float : none !important;
height : 0px !important;
clear : both !important;
font-size : 0px !important;
}

div#header {
width: 100%;
height: 384px;
background:url(../images/headbg.png) repeat-x;
}

div#header div.wrap {
height: 384px;
background:url(../images/hdbgwr.png) no-repeat;
}

div#header div#logo {
position: absolute;
margin: 0px;
width: 220px;
height: 110px;
}

div#header div#menu {
position: absolute;
margin-top: 10px;
margin-left: 344px;
width: 656px;
height: 48px;
}

div#content div#people {
position: absolute;
margin-top: -340px;
margin-left: 339px;
width: 322px;
height: 440px;
background:url(../images/people.gif) no-repeat;
}

div#header div#witamy {
position: absolute;
margin-top: 145px;
margin-left: 18px;
width: 300px;
min-height: 150px;
}

div#header div#witamy div.title {
width: 153px;
height: 20px;
background:url(../images/witamy.png) no-repeat;
}

div#header div#witamy div.txt {
padding-top: 15px;
line-height: 170%;
}

div#header div#ostatnia {
position: absolute;
margin-top: 110px;
margin-left: 680px;
width: 227px;
height: 266px;
}

div#header div#ostatnia div.title {
width: 143px;
height: 45px;
margin-left: 60px;
background:url(../images/ostatnia.png) no-repeat;
}

div#header div#ostatnia div.miniatura {
width: 288px;
height: 227px;
margin-top: -10px;
}

div#content {
width: 100%;
}

div#content div.wrap {
padding-top: 50px;	
}

div#content div.wrap div#skontaktuj {
width: 350px;
height: 105px;
margin-left: 0px;
}

div#stopka {
width: 100%;
}

div#stopka div.wrap {
padding-top: 40px;
padding-bottom: 15px;
}

div#stopka div.wrap div#stopkal {
width: 350px;
float: left;
padding-top: 15px;
padding-left: 10px;
text-align: left;
border-top: 1px solid #b5b5b5;
font-size: 11px;
color: #959595;
}

div#stopka div.wrap div#stopkac {
width: 280px;
float: left;
padding-top: 15px;
border-top: 1px solid #ececec;
}

div#stopka div.wrap div#stopkar {
width: 350px;
float: left;
padding-top: 15px;
padding-right: 10px;
text-align: right;
border-top: 1px solid #b5b5b5;
font-size: 11px;
color: #959595;
}

a.stopka:link, a.stopka:visited, a.stopka:active {
font-size: 11px;
font-family : Tahoma, Arial, Sans-Serif;
font-weight: normal;
color: #959595;
text-decoration: none;
}

a.stopka:hover {
font-size: 11px;
font-family : Tahoma, Arial, Sans-Serif;
font-weight: normal;
color: #444444;
text-decoration: underline;
}

div#strefa {
position: absolute;
margin-top: -120px;
margin-left: 710px;
width: 233px;
}

div#strefa div#formtop {
width: 233px;
height: 13px;
background:url(../images/form_top.jpg) no-repeat;
}

div#strefa div#formstrefa {
width: 233px;
height: 20px;
background:url(../images/form_strefa.jpg) no-repeat;
}

div#strefa div#formstrefa div#niepamietam {
margin-left: 15px;
}

a.przyp:link, a.przyp:visited, a.przyp:active {
font-size: 11px;
font-family : Tahoma, Arial, Sans-Serif;
font-weight: normal;
color: #444444;
text-decoration: underline;
}

a.przyp:hover {
font-size: 11px;
font-family : Tahoma, Arial, Sans-Serif;
font-weight: normal;
color: #444444;
text-decoration: none;
}

div#strefa div#forminner {
width: 233px;

background:url(../images/form_inner.jpg) repeat-y;
}

div#strefa div#formbtm {
width: 233px;
height: 12px;
background:url(../images/form_btm.jpg) no-repeat;
}

div#strefa div#forminner div#formlogin {
width: 203px;
height: auto !important;
padding-left: 15px;
padding-right: 5px;
}

div#formlogin {
padding-top: 10px;
}

div#formlogin FORM INPUT.login {
width: 95%;
padding: 5px;
background-color: #ffffff;
border: 1px solid #d2d2d2;
font-size: 11px;
color: #444444;
display: block;
}

div#formlogin FORM INPUT.pass {
width: 65%;
padding: 5px;
background-color: #ffffff;
border: 1px solid #d2d2d2;
font-size: 11px;
color: #444444;
}

input.button {
width: 47px;
height: 25px;
background:url(../images/login.jpg) no-repeat;
border: none;
cursor : pointer;
}

div#content div.wrap div#adres {
position: absolute;
margin-top: -105px;
margin-left: 400px;
width: 300px;
}

h1.index, h2.index {
padding-right: 5px;
display: inline;
font-family : Tahoma, Arial, Sans-Serif;
font-size : 12px;
font-weight : bold;
color : #444444;
text-decoration : none;
}

a.kontakt:link, a.kontakt:visited, a.kontakt:active {
font-size: 12px;
font-family : Tahoma, Arial, Sans-Serif;
font-weight: normal;
color: #444444;
text-decoration: underline;
}

a.kontakt:hover {
font-size: 12px;
font-family : Tahoma, Arial, Sans-Serif;
font-weight: normal;
color: #f3aa1e;
text-decoration: underline;
}

div#swieta {
position: absolute;
top: 50px;
left: 160px;
width: 90px;
height: 64px;
}

div#zyczenia {
display: block;
opacity: 0;
filter: alpha(opacity=0);
background:url(../images/zyczenia.png) no-repeat;
position: absolute;
top: -390px;
left: 200px;
width: 600px;
height: 200px;
background-color: #ffffff;
border: 1px solid #aeaeae;
font-size: 14px;
font-family : Tahoma, Arial, Sans-Serif;
font-weight: normal;
color: #454545;
line-height: 180%;
}

div#wesolychswiat {
display: block;
opacity: 0;
filter: alpha(opacity=0);
background:url(../images/nowyrok.gif) no-repeat;
position: absolute;
width: 150px;
height: 70px;
top: 70px;
left: 240px;
}